Type: Difficulty: Length: Trail Easy 2.0 Miles One Way Tailrace Marina in Mount Holly Tailrace Marina Located on the Catawba River in Mount Holly Tailrace Marina is located on the Catawba River in Mount Holly. Located across the Catawba river is the U.S. National Whitewater Center. There is a wide array of services offered including kayak, paddleboard and pontoon boat rentals, boat slip leasing with 191 public and private, covered and uncovered varying in length from 20 to 28 feet. J.R. Cash’s Grill and Bar is onsite as well. Tailrace Marina offers a variety of personal vessels available for hourly and daily rental. We offer single and double kayaks, canoes, and stand-up paddle boards, as well as a pontoon for parties. Serving Gaston County Citizens Extension has offices in every county of North Carolina and the Eastern Band of Cherokee. The staff and volunteers work with local government to support agriculture, horticulture, conservation and environmental protection, nutrition and health, as well as a variety of consumer, youth, and economic concerns. Core Focus Areas Agriculture and Food Extension keeps North Carolina’s $96 billion agriculture industry growing and sustainable by connecting producers with research-based information and technology they need. Health and Nutrition Extension helps people make healthier decisions, reduce their risk of chronic disease and live better lives through a wealth of programs from nutrition to local foods to food safety. 4-H Youth Development Extension’s 4-H programs address the diverse issues of today’s youth, helping hundreds of thousands of youth grow into healthier, more involved generations of future leaders. Type: Difficulty: Length: Sidewalk, Paved Easy 2.1 miles, One Way Crowders Mountain State Park Crowders Mountain State Park Climb rugged peaks rising 800 feet above the surrounding countryside and 1,600 feet above sea level. Rocky ledges and outcrops are the perfect seats from which to view the panorama below. A visit to Crowders Mountain might include hiking more than 20 miles of hiking trails, rock climbing, backcountry camping, picnicking and fishing. Additional features include a visitors center with restrooms and exhibit hall. Educational programs are also offered. Crowders Mountain is free. Mother Nature blessed Gaston County with a pop-up mountain range in the heart of the Carolina Piedmont. This small range is anchored by Crowders Mountain and Kings Pinnacle, the centerpieces of Crowders Mountain State Park. Crowders is an adventure lover’s dream — 5,210 undisturbed acres just 15 minutes from downtown Gastonia and easily accessible by Interstate 85. The park, one of the most popular in the North Carolina State Parks system, was founded in the early 1970s thanks to an effort by Gaston Conservation Society to preserve this unique mountain range from the threat of a large-scale mining operation. More land was acquired in 1988, and in 2000, an additional 2,000 acres were added to connect Crowders Mountain State Park with Kings Mountain National Military Park just across the state line in South Carolina. ACTIVITIES FOR ALL HIKE, BIKE OR FISH Within the park’s confines are adventures big and small. Hike the short but steep trail to the summit of Crowders Mountain to view Charlotte’s modern skyline in the distance, or stretch it out with the 12-mile (round trip) Ridgeline Trail that connects Crowders Mountain to Kings Pinnacle. Softer adventure can be had on several other trails, or enjoy paddling and fishing in the park’s secluded seven-acre lake. Park staff hosts events and volunteer workshops throughout the year, and primitive camping is available in two areas. A family camping area has 10 sites, and a group camping area (ADA accessible) has 11 sites. Each area offers grills, picnic tables, tent pads, drinking water and vault toilets. CONQUER CROWDERS Many outdoor enthusiasts are satisfied with the strenuous hike to the “top of the world” at Crowders Mountain’s rocky peak. Conquering this steep, rocky ascent is a worthy achievement, and the payoff is a spectacular view of the North Carolina Piedmont. Heartier souls prefer another method of conquering Crowders: scaling the 150-foot sheer rock cliffs to the summit. Rock climbing is allowed by park permit, and climbers must bring their own equipment. An even stiffer challenge is bouldering, which is also allowed by park permit. Park at the Boulders Access Area and hike one mile to the Boulders. DOGS ARE CLIMBERS TOO Crowders Mountain State Park allows dogs on all 11 trails, provided they are on a leash no more than six feet in length. The 11 trails vary in difficultly from easy to strenuous, so be sure to pick the right route for your pup (and you). Please note the trails at Crowders Mountain are quite popular with humans, particularly during weekends, so keep that in mind when planning a hike with your dog. If you visit during a peak time, you will likely encounter a lot of two-legged and four-legged traffic along the way. MORE IN: Kings Mountain 01/19 - 01/23 Deal Park 211 N.
